How is CMII converted to numbers?

To convert CMII to numbers the translation involves breaking the numeral into place values (ones, tens, hundreds, thousands), like this:

Place ValueNumberRoman Numeral
Conversion900 + 2CM + II
Hundreds900CM
Ones2II

How is CMII written in numbers?

To write CMII as numbers correctly you combine the converted roman numerals together. The highest numerals should always precede the lower numerals to provide you the correct written translation, like in the table above.

900+2 = (CMII) = 902
